Using room temperature cream cheese ensures a smoother batter, preventing lumps that might ruin your silky cheesecake texture.

Be careful not to overbake your cheesecake; it should still have a slight jiggle in the center when done to maintain its creamy consistency.

Let your cheesecake cool completely before refrigerating; this helps set its texture and enhances the flavors as they meld together beautifully.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 ripe mangoes (about 1 cup pureed)
  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 2 tbsp cornstarch

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 320°F (160°C).
  2. Line a springform pan with parchment paper and grease the sides.
  3. In a mixing bowl, beat softened cream cheese and sugar until smooth.
  4. Add e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
  5. Incorporate heavy cream and cornstarch; blend until silky-smooth.
  6. Gently fold in pureed mango until evenly mixed.
  7.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and bake for about 60 minutes, or until slightly jiggly in the center.
  8. Let cool completely before refrigerating for at least four hours.
